How much do industrial engineering student j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 12, 2026, the average hourly pay for industrial engineering student in Quebec is $32.16,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$18.27 and $43.75 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an industrial engineering student?

To thrive as an Industrial Engineering Student, you need a strong grasp of mathematics, problem-solving, and analytical thinking, typically supported by coursework in systems engineering, statistics, and operations research. Familiarity with technical tools like AutoCAD, MATLAB, simulation software, and Excel, as well as knowledge of lean manufacturing principles, is often expected. Effective teamwork, communication, and adaptability help students excel in group projects and internships. These skills and qualities are crucial for successfully applying engineering concepts to real-world process improvements and preparing for a professional career.

What can I do with an industrial engineering student degree?

An industrial engineering student degree prepares individuals for roles in process improvement, operations management, supply chain, quality control, and manufacturing. Graduates often work as industrial engineers, operations analysts, or production managers, utilizing skills in data analysis, systems optimization, and project management. Certifications like Six Sigma or Lean can enhance job prospects in these fields.

What is an industrial engineering student?

Industrial engineering students are individuals who are studying the principles and practices of industrial engineering, a field focused on optimizing complex systems, processes, and organizations. They learn about subjects like operations research, production planning, quality control, ergonomics, and supply chain management. These students develop problem-solving and analytical skills aimed at improving efficiency, productivity, and safety in various industries. Their education prepares them for careers in manufacturing, logistics, healthcare, and more.

What jobs can industrial engineering students do?

Industrial engineering students can pursue roles such as manufacturing engineer, process analyst, quality control technician, supply chain coordinator, or operations analyst. These positions often involve skills in process optimization, data analysis, and use of tools like CAD or ERP systems, and may require internships or entry-level experience.

What types of real-world projects or responsibilities can industrial engineering students expect during internships or co-op positions?

Industrial Engineering students in internships or co-op roles often participate in process improvement projects, data analysis, and workflow optimization within manufacturing or service environments. They may be tasked with mapping out production processes, conducting time studies, or assisting with the implementation of lean methodologies. Collaboration with cross-functional teams—such as quality assurance, operations, and logistics—is common, providing valuable experience in both technical and interpersonal skills. These experiences not only enhance problem-solving abilities but also prepare students for full-time industrial engineering roles after graduation.

Position Summary

The Mechanical Engineer Student is responsible in helping the Continuous Improvement Coordinator for planning, guiding, and developing Continuous Improvement and LEAN activities for the manufacturing of custom HVAC products.

Roles and Responsibilities

  • Ensure the Continuous Improvement of processes with a focus on lead time, productivity, quality, and competitiveness
  • Lead and facilitate Continuous Improvement and LEAN activities such as 5S, VSM, Kaizen events that drive business improvement
  • Implements a Lean management system and ensures that all elements such as standardized processes are in place to drive sustainable results
  • Provide useful training and support for all Continuous Improvement activities and concepts to employees
  • Sponsor the coordination of improvement processes between the employees & departments in order to improve the standardization of business practices
  • Collaborate with our corporate Lean team (Marmon) to ensure the cohesion of local activities and the production of reports, update, and communication
  • Other responsibilities as assigned
